Safety and In-Person Meetings
Village may facilitate in-person connections through features like Seat at My Table and local Gatherings. Your safety is your responsibility, and we take it seriously.
Before meeting someone in person:
- Meet in a public place for the first time
- Tell a trusted friend or family member where you're going and who you're meeting
- Drive yourself or use your own transportation
- Trust your instincts — if something feels off, leave
- Do not share your home address until you're comfortable
Report anything that makes you feel unsafe. We would rather receive 100 reports that turn out to be nothing than miss one that matters.

Blocking
You can block any member at any time for any reason. Blocking is:
- Instant
- Private (the blocked person is not notified)
- Permanent (unless you choose to unblock)
- No explanation required
You do not need to justify blocking someone. If someone makes you uncomfortable, block them.
